The Office Manager is responsible for overseeing the day-to-day operations of the office and ensuring that business runs smoothly.

  • Organizing meetings and managing databases
  • Dealing with correspondence, complaints, and queries from clients and other stakeholders
  • Supervising and monitoring the work of company staff to ensure that tasks are completed on time and to a high standard
  • Implementing and maintaining procedures and office administrative systems to improve efficiency and productivity
  • Organizing induction programs for new employees to ensure that they are properly trained and equipped to perform their roles
  • Ensuring that health and safety policies are up-to-date and that all employees are aware of and adhere to them
  • Attending meetings with senior management to provide updates on office operations and to receive feedback
  • Partnering with HR to update and maintain office policies as necessary
  • Ensuring all items are invoiced and paid on time to maintain the organisation s financial health.

The ideal candidate should have excellent organizational and communication skills, the ability to multitask and prioritize effectively, and a good understanding of office management best practices. Additionally, experience with relevant software such as Microsoft Office, and various database systems is required.

  • A track record of at least 1 year of work experience in a similar role, such as Office Manager, Front Office Manager, or Administrative Assistant
  • Proven experience in managing and overseeing office operations, including managing staff and implementing and maintaining procedures and systems
  • Knowledge of office administration responsibilities, systems, and procedures
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office, specifically in Excel and Outlook
  • Familiarity with email scheduling tools, such as Email Scheduler
  • Excellent time management skills and ability to multitask and prioritize work effectively
  • Attention to detail and problem-solving abilities
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Strong organizational and planning skills, with the ability to work in a fast-paced environment
  • A creative mind with the ability to suggest improvements and drive change within the office.
